Panama fears price-gouging over virus

Wednesday, March 11, 2020


As shoppers reacting to the news of Panama’s first coronavirus case crowded into supermarkets and stores on Tuesday, March 10 to stock up on alcohol-based cleaning products and gels, the Consumer Protection Authority warned against price gouging.

The entity’s director Jorge Quintero, said that if traders speculate on the prices of hygiene items, they could recommend to the Executive to apply price controls to the items, Newsroom Panama reports.
